From Prospecting to Closeout: Mastering the Grant Funding Lifecycle
Rather than focusing on proposal writing alone, the course helps participants understand grant readiness, funding strategy, and the systems required to pursue and manage grants responsibly. Participants will learn how funders think, how to assess organizational fit for funding opportunities, and how to build internal practices that support successful grant pursuit and stewardship.
The course addresses common misconceptions about grants, explores equity-centered grantmaking considerations, and provides practical tools for deciding when -- and when not -- to apply. Emphasis is placed on clarity, alignment, and long-term capacity building rather than chasing funding at all costs.
